Career path

Career Role (Precision Engineering for Fabricators) Description
CNC Machinist/Programmer Operate and program CNC machines for precise fabrication, vital for high-volume manufacturing. Requires expertise in CAD/CAM software and precision engineering techniques.
Precision Welder Perform high-precision welding techniques like TIG and MIG, essential for joining components in aerospace and automotive industries. Demonstrates proficiency in quality control and precision engineering.
Quality Control Inspector (Precision Engineering) Inspect fabricated parts for accuracy and conformity to specifications, employing advanced measuring tools and quality assurance methods. Crucial for maintaining precision engineering standards.
Maintenance Technician (Precision Machinery) Maintain and repair sophisticated precision engineering machinery ensuring optimal functionality and uptime. Requires a strong understanding of mechanical and electrical systems.
Robotics & Automation Technician Integrate and maintain robotic systems in automated fabrication processes. A growing field requiring advanced skills in precision engineering and automation technology.
